VARIETAL INDICES FOR SEED YIELD AND DROUGHT TOLERANCE INDEX IN CHICKPEA UNDER DIFFERENT ENVIRONMENTS
1AICRP on Chickpea,
Jawaharlal Nehru Krishi Vishwa Vidyalaya
RAK College of Agriculture, Sehore 466 001 M.P. India
ABSTRACT
An attempt was made to know the genetic merits of chickpea genotypes based on linear combination of yield components tested in six environments, created by adjusting the moisture availability in three subsequent years for seed yield and drought tolerance index. The estimates of varietal indices varied from genotype to genotype in different environments. Pusa 362 and Ieee 4958 in rainfed condition and Pusa 256 and JG 130 in irrigated conditions appeared as promising genotypes for seed yield. Similarly, ICCC 4958, KPG59, Pusa 362 and JG 130 appeared as promising donor for drought tolerance index based on genetic merits of yield factors in chickpea.
